Overview

The Experience Specialist NE is responsible for basic patient experience, ensuring a seamless experience for patients and visitors. The role extends a professional welcome, assists with paperwork, and guides patients to the appropriate departments. The role addresses general patient inquiries, answers the incoming calls and escalates urgent concerns to experience specialist leads. The role supports in maintaining accurate patient records in the EMR system and collects patient feedback.

Responsibilities

  • Extends a professional welcome to all patients and visitors, providing information on services and procedures.

  • Serves as the first point of contact for patients and visitors, caters to general patient interactions, assisting with check-in and check-out, ensuring a smooth and efficient registration process.

  • Guides patients to appropriate departments , clinics, or service areas.

  • Keeps patients and families updated about wait times, physician availability, and procedural delays.

  • Assis ts patients in completing paperwork, including consent forms, intake forms, and insurance documentation.

  • Addresses general patient inquiries, concerns, and complaints with empathy and escalates complex or urgent matters to experience specialist II.

  • Offers guidance on charges, payment processes, insurance procedures, and provides non-medical information to patients if needed.

  • Supports in maintaining latest patient records in the EMR system, ensuring data accuracy.

  • Answers incoming calls, providing basic information and forwarding calls to the concerned department .

  • Ensures all patient interactions and data handling comply with confidentiality regulations and UPH standards.

  • Participates in training programs to stay updated on best practices in patient care and healthcare regulations.

Qualifications

Education:

  • High School Diploma or equivalent required.

Experience:

  • Previous customer service experience in hospital or healthcare setting preferred.

License(s)/Certification(s):

  • None.
